一款易语言高级表格操作模块

易语言 2020-08-19 11:34:26

一款易语言高级表格操作模块

1、#表格常量.文本型;2、#表格常量.数值型;3、#表格常量.日期型;4、#表格常量.列表型;5、#表格常量.选择型;6、#表格常量.图片型;7、#表格常量.货币型;8、#表格常量.不可编辑列表型。

.子程序 文本替换12, 文本型, 公开, 批量替换文本;
.参数 原文本, 文本型, ,
.参数 替换进行的次数, 整数型, 可空,, 可空;参数值指定对子文本进行替换的次数。如果省略,默认进行所有可能的替换。
.参数 替换的起始位置, 整数型, 可空,, 可空;参数值指定被替换子文本的起始搜索位置。如果省略,默认从 1 开始
.参数 是否区分大小写, 逻辑型, 可空,, 可空; 初始值为“假”不区分大小写;为真区分大小写。

.子程序 程序_禁止重复运行, , 公开, 禁止当前程序多开运行
.参数 标识文本, 文本型, 可空,, 尽量输复杂一点的文本
.参数 是否弹出信息框提示, 逻辑型, 可空,, 默认为假,不弹出提示;
.参数 消息框提示文本, 文本型, 可空,, 第二个参数设置为假,该参数则无效
.参数 消息框提示图标, 整数型, 可空,, 默认为信息图标,如:#信息图标
.参数 是否前端显示程序, 逻辑型, 可空,, 如果已重复运行,是否将程序在前端显示

.子程序 文本_删中间2, 文本型, 公开, 本命令会删除前面文本和后面文本之间的所有内容(包括后面文本),如文本中含有多个前面文本或后面文本则删除首个前面文本与最后一个后面文本之间的所有内容。
.参数 原文本, 文本型, , 待处理的文本
.参数 前面文本, 文本型, ,
.参数 后面文本, 文本型, ,
.参数 是否不区分大小写, 逻辑型, 可空,, 默认为假,即区分大小写。
.参数 保留前面文本, 逻辑型, 可空,, 默认为假
.参数 保留后面文本, 逻辑型, 可空,, 默认为假